A raft of wood of mass 120 kg floats in water. The weight that can be put on the raft to make it just sink should be (draft = 600 kg/m3) :
80 kg
50 kg
60 kg
30 kg
A.
80 kg
The volume of the raft is given by
If the raft is immersed fully in water, then the weight of water displaced is
= Vdwater
= 0.2 × 103 = 200 kg
Hence, the additional weight which can be put on the raft
= 200 kg - 120 kg = 80 kg
